		<description>I never really meal planned. Dont really now either.
But when my son was young, and I was a single parent at the time., I did a really good job of budgeting by doing this.

On my route to work was 3 grocery stores ...
so I would routinely check the flyers each week.
whatever specials apealed to me ..(from the grocery stores on my way) I would purchase and sometime stock(if the price was really good) 
that way we ate a nice variety of good stuff and I didnt make any extra trips to do my grocery shopping.

sometimes in the winter I would actually grocery shop before work cus the car was nice and chilly perfect to keep those things till home-time...and if it was a really good special I would get it before it was SOLD out as well.
